The U.S. House of Representatives passed a bill on Saturday that would force TikTok’s parent company to either sell the service within a year or cease operating in the U.S. It follows a similar bill from last month, which has a six-month deadline. 15 injured on tram collision at Universal Studios theme park
More than a dozen people suffered mostly minor injuries when a tram used for tours crashed into a railing at Universal Studios Hollywood near Los Angeles, authorities and the company said. Watch: Circus elephant takes to the street after being startled
The sound of a vehicle backfiring spooked a circus elephant while she was getting a pre-show bath in Butte, Montana, leading the pachyderm to break through a fence and take a brief walk, stopping noontime traffic on the city’s busiest street before being loaded back into a trailer.
